Anyway to unblock the phone to use other SIM cards without going via Rogers or paying for it?

My problem is that I had my BB unblocked and now had to get a replacement BB for a different reason which comes blocked. They want me to pay again $150 to unblock it!

Actually there would be 2 ;) T-Mobile (which locks by default, but unlocks after 6 months of good service) and Cingular (which never locks any of their devices). I don't know why, however rumor has it, now that the subsidy law was passed in CA, that it will soon become nationwide, and no more subsidy lock *cheers*, however the bad news is, prices will go up higher :(
